diff options
| author | Christian Grothoff <christian@grothoff.org> | 2017-07-04 23:28:03 +0200 | 
|---|---|---|
| committer | Christian Grothoff <christian@grothoff.org> | 2017-07-04 23:28:03 +0200 | 
| commit | f9950799fc21c6847d13f93aaec2cd6a555d546a (patch) | |
| tree | 02816ec563bf39fb4e719fb284a1b05ed09f7161 /src/auditordb | |
| parent | d77c4160ecf7b1d33d49ba47e3236f5dcc14ecc8 (diff) | |
eliminate dead macros
Diffstat (limited to 'src/auditordb')
| -rw-r--r-- | src/auditordb/plugin_auditordb_postgres.c | 66 | 
1 files changed, 0 insertions, 66 deletions
| diff --git a/src/auditordb/plugin_auditordb_postgres.c b/src/auditordb/plugin_auditordb_postgres.c index e02e69a2..38894c8c 100644 --- a/src/auditordb/plugin_auditordb_postgres.c +++ b/src/auditordb/plugin_auditordb_postgres.c @@ -31,72 +31,6 @@  /** - * Log a query error. - * - * @param result PQ result object of the query that failed - */ -#define QUERY_ERR(result)                          \ -  LOG (GNUNET_ERROR_TYPE_ERROR, "Query failed at %s:%u: %s (%s)\n", __FILE__, __LINE__, PQresultErrorMessage (result), PQresStatus (PQresultStatus (result))) - - -/** - * Log a really unexpected PQ error. - * - * @param result PQ result object of the PQ operation that failed - */ -#define BREAK_DB_ERR(result) do { \ -    GNUNET_break (0); \ -    LOG (GNUNET_ERROR_TYPE_ERROR, "Database failure: %s (%s)\n", PQresultErrorMessage (result), PQresStatus (PQresultStatus (result))); \ -  } while (0) - - -/** - * Shorthand for exit jumps.  Logs the current line number - * and jumps to the "EXITIF_exit" label. - * - * @param cond condition that must be TRUE to exit with an error - */ -#define EXITIF(cond)                                              \ -  do {                                                            \ -    if (cond) { GNUNET_break (0); goto EXITIF_exit; }             \ -  } while (0) - - -/** - * Execute an SQL statement and log errors on failure. Must be - * run in a function that has an "SQLEXEC_fail" label to jump - * to in case the SQL statement failed. - * - * @param conn database connection - * @param sql SQL statement to run - */ -#define SQLEXEC_(conn, sql)                                             \ -  do {                                                                  \ -    PGresult *result = PQexec (conn, sql);                              \ -    if (PGRES_COMMAND_OK != PQresultStatus (result))                    \ -    {                                                                   \ -      BREAK_DB_ERR (result);                                            \ -      PQclear (result);                                                 \ -      goto SQLEXEC_fail;                                                \ -    }                                                                   \ -    PQclear (result);                                                   \ -  } while (0) - - -/** - * Run an SQL statement, ignoring errors and clearing the result. - * - * @param conn database connection - * @param sql SQL statement to run - */ -#define SQLEXEC_IGNORE_ERROR_(conn, sql)                                \ -  do {                                                                  \ -    PGresult *result = PQexec (conn, sql);                              \ -    PQclear (result);                                                   \ -  } while (0) - - -/**   * Handle for a database session (per-thread, for transactions).   */  struct TALER_AUDITORDB_Session | 
